PHP also known as hypertext preprocessor is one of the most popular programming languages used for Website Development. It is an open source scripting language for the server side. Over the years PHP has evolved a lot. Now a day, PHP frameworks are being used to simplify the PHP web development procedure. These frameworks are basically used for streamlining and speeding up the web development processes. A PHP framework may be referred to as a platform consisting of a library of codes that facilitate the development of websites or web applications.
The list of PHP frameworks that are ideal for web development includes:
Lavarel is a free open source PHP framework suitable for developing complex web applications. It is faster as compared to other PHP frameworks. It also eases up the common development tasks such as caching, routing, sessions, and authentication.
Codeigniter is a straightforward, lightweight PHP framework suitable for developing dynamic websites. It offers a simplified procedure for installation and comprises of MVC architecture, inbuilt security tools, and error handling procedures.
CakePHP is one of the easiest frameworks to develop feature-loaded websites with visually appealing elements. Some of the distinguishing characteristics of this framework include cross-site request forgery (CSRF) protection, cross-site scripting (XSS) prevention and SQL injection prevention.
This PHP framework is suitable for developing websites for large scale enterprises. Symfony is highly flexible and can also be integrated Drupal. The framework also comprises of a large array of reusable Php components.
The Zend Php framework is an object-oriented framework that is widely preferred for large scale IT departments and financial institutions. The prominent features of this framework include data encryption, MVC components, session management, and simple cloud API integration.